When it comes to creating unique and intricate designs on stainless steel, etching is a popular technique that can produce stunning results Etching involves using a strong acid or abrasive substance to remove layers of the metal surface, creating a pattern or design This process can be used to create anything from simple logos and text to intricate artwork and patterns.
Stainless steel is a popular choice for etching due to its durability and resistance to corrosion The process of etching stainless steel involves several steps, each of which plays a crucial role in achieving the desired results.
The first step in etching stainless steel is preparing the metal surface This involves cleaning the surface to remove any dirt, oil, or grease that may interfere with the etching process The surface must be thoroughly cleaned to ensure that the acid or abrasive substance can effectively remove the metal.
Next, a design or pattern is created on a special type of film or mask that will be used to transfer the design onto the stainless steel This mask is carefully applied to the metal surface and firmly pressed down to ensure that it adheres properly.
Once the mask is in place, the stainless steel is ready to be etched The etching process involves applying a strong acid or abrasive substance to the metal surface The acid or abrasive substance removes the top layers of the metal, creating a depression where the design or pattern is etched.
The etching process can be done by hand using a brush or sponge, or it can be done using an automated etching machine Automated etching machines are often used for large-scale projects or when a high level of precision is required.
After the etching process is complete, the mask is removed to reveal the design or pattern that has been etched into the stainless steel etch stainless steel. The metal surface is then cleaned and polished to remove any residue from the etching process.

In addition to its aesthetic appeal, etching stainless steel also offers practical benefits Etched designs and patterns can be used to create functional elements such as signage, nameplates, or identification tags Etching can also be used to create patterns that improve the grip or texture of a stainless steel surface, making it safer and more practical for certain applications.
Etching stainless steel is a skill that requires precision, patience, and attention to detail It is important to follow the proper safety precautions when etching stainless steel, as the acids and abrasive substances used in the process can be hazardous if not handled correctly.
